Now that you mention it, Ji, the frantic production of bulbils in petiolatum is a result of the stupid mania of potting Hippeastrum uprooted, with the bulb exposed. I never found any wild petiolatum (and many other species) with exposed bulbs, all had an 2-3 in. neck below the ground and invariably had a few bulbils attached.

The two or three species that are epiphytic by force are completely exceptional in the genus.
